The review also highlights Consul InSight's patent-pending W7 methodology, which translates disparate log data into a common, English-based language to consolidate, normalize normalize to convert a set of data by, for example, converting them to logarithms or reciprocals so that their previous non-normal distribution is converted to a normal one. and analyze vast amounts of user and system activity. "Its [Consul InSight] user-centric W7 model parses information into when, what, where, who, from-where (source), on-what and where-to categories--a simple but effective scheme for analyzing and reporting significant activity."
